Leyla Acaroglu

Sociologist, Designer & Sustainability Strategist

A disruptive designer on a mission to make the world better.

Leyla Acaroglu is a sociologist, a designer, and a leading voice on sustainability, innovation, and social change. She is a trusted advisor to major corporations and a passionate advocate for a more human-centered and purpose-driven approach to business. Acaroglu’s work is a powerful counterpoint to a world of corporate shortsightedness, offering a clear, pragmatic, and actionable guide to creating a more productive and fulfilling workplace.

Acaroglu is the founder of Disrupt Design, a company that provides tools and training to help people and organizations create a more sustainable and resilient future. She is a leading voice on the importance of a growth mindset, and her work is focused on helping people to overcome their fears and achieve their goals. She is a frequent speaker at major conferences and a regular contributor to business publications.

Recent Topics

The Disruptive Design Method: A New Approach to Problem Solving

A breakdown of her unique framework for using systems thinking and design to create positive social and environmental change.

The Invisible Design of Everyday Life

An eye-opening talk on the hidden systems and design choices that shape our behavior and impact the world around us.

Unlocking Your Agency: How to Be a Regenerator, Not a Consumer

A call to action for individuals to take ownership of their impact and use their creativity to design a better future.

Designing for a Sustainable Future: A Systems Thinking Approach

A deep dive into how understanding complex systems can help us create more effective and enduring solutions to environmental challenges.
